NEW TO PROACTIVE VACATIONS! "Sea Ya at Holden" is a BRAND NEW construction home that has been charmingly decorated with no detail left behind. Boasting nautical decor, a sizable private pool, elevator, and highly sought after inverted floorplan. Located across from the Intracoastal Waterway on the calming Lois Ave. on Holden Beach.

Take the elevator up to the top floor and you will be met with an open kitchen / living area. The well equipped kitchen provides ample countertop space to make delicious treats to appreciate together. Head into the living room to find comfortable seating with a enormous flat screen TV ideal for movie nights or family game nighttime. A convenient half bath is located off of the living area. You will find the master bedroom on this floor. Downstairs you will find 3 coastal bedrooms, with 3 full bathrooms. The secondary living area is complete with comfortable furnishings with a queen sleeper couch (linens not included) and a huge flat screen TV.
Bedroom 1: Queen Bed, Semi-Private Bathroom with Walk-in Shower, East Side
Bedroom 2: Queen Bed, Private Bathroom with Tub / Shower combo, West Side
Bedroom 3: Queen Bed, TV, Private Bathroom with Walk-in Shower, West Side
Bedroom 4: 2nd Floor, King Bed, TV, Private Bathroom with Walk-in Shower, East Side
Outside your private getaway waits! The huge swimming pool accepts for sunbathing or calming pool side. After a day in the surf savor the enclosed outdoor shower, making the transition from outside to inside simple. Unwind on one of the covered decks with the ocean air breeze. We can't wait to "Sea Ya at Holden"!

This Property is Located at 228 Lois Ave.

This is a NO PET Property

Swimming pools are open each year from April 15 thru October 15. Pool heating is not available for this home. Pools are cleaned prior to arrival, and also cleaned mid-stay for 7 nighttime units.

When to reserve a Wrightsville Beach rental & When to go:

  • To get the best value, shift your group's vacation to the Spring or Fall months. May, September, and October offer excellent temperatures, less crowded beaches, and greatly reduced traffic.
  • In the Wrightsville Beach area, The earlier you can book a rental home, the easier your search will be. The most desirable rental properties are booked very early. Booking your rental property six - twelve months before your travel dates is recommended. Christmas, Thanksgiving and New Years Eve are excellent times to search for and reserve your rental home.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property manager whether your family qualifies for a reduced rate.
  • Booking websites usually offer guests an option to purchase trip insurance. Trip insurance, which will generally cost between 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ather disasters,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Find a copy of your local Wrightsville Beach visitors guide mag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ental home do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ers. In addition to great local articles, travel guide magazines have coupons for local accommodations, restaurants and tours.

More tips for your stay:

  • Be sure you get the owner's contact number and arrival/departure procedures for your rental property.
  • To ensure that damages are not linked to your family's visit, inspect the rental for any problem areas during check in. Call the property manager immediately to relay any issues. If there is a dispute about who is responsible, having a record of problems and contact attempts will be useful.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a hot tub, A/V setup or coffee maker.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ief text message can prevent a lot of concerns.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You will enhance your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ors are usually an excellent resource to find the best local beaches and restaurants.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Local residents can frequently help. Who better to ask where to find the best bike paths, have a great night out,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Lock your rental while you're out. Keep your property safe!
  • Double-check every room of the property to confirm that you've packed all belongings at check-out. Make sure to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den treasure.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• Did you have a excellent vacation? Most vacation rental websites make it easy for customers to provide reviews. If your rental and/or property manager was wonderful, they always love to hear your praise. If anything was inoperable and they failed to address it reasonably,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make a note as part of your review.

Victory Beach Vacations

Visitors who are on the hunt for the postcard-perfect vacation rental in the heart of the Carolina Beach or Kure Beach area will find an enticing selection and plenty of friendly customer service when they rent through Victory Beach Vacations. Based in Carolina Beach in the coastal Cape Fear region, Victory Beach Vacations has more than 100 vacation rentals in all shapes and sizes to ensure that every vacationing family can find their dream home away from home on the beach.   When you book your Cape Fear getaway with Victory Beach Vacations, the fun doesn’t end when you leave the beach, it continues with an array of privately-owned properties outfitted with all of the amenities needed for a fabulous beach vacation.   Jenna Lanier, General Manager, explains that her family first opened the rental and property management business in 2002. At the forefront of Victory Beach operations is Lanier’s mother, Caroline Meeks. Meeks is both the Broker in Charge and co-owner with husband, Buck Meeks, who manages the Field Services team with Lanier’s husband, Scott.   For nearly 20 years, the Victory Beach team has worked tirelessly to establish a network of top-of-the-line rental properties for Cape Fear visitors to enjoy. “As far as our properties go,” explains Lanier, “they are all updated, well-furnished and appointed. “We have always performed post-cleaning inspections and since the pandemic, have put freshly laundered duvets over all of the comforters between rentals.”   Lanier emphasizes how important the guests experience is “we strive to give our guests a relaxing, stress free, memorable vacation.” This emphasis on customer service has led to Victory Beach Vacations having a 4.8 Google rating with over 300 reviews by happy owners and guests.In addition to Victory Beach’s superior sanitation practices, the company offers properties for every type of visitor. Choose from luxury oceanfront houses and condos to more reasonbly priced 2nd row properties with oceanviews.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al. We have several properties on the harbor so guests can bring their boat, kayak, [or jet ski] and travel between islands,” says Lanier.   A stay with Victory Beach Vacations is an annual pilgrimage for most. “A large percentage of guests are previous guests. Some even reserve the same property for the next year as they’re checking out,” Lanier says. “It’s almost like it’s their personal vacation home.”   Even before guests arrive at their vacation destination, the Victory Beach Vacations’ website greets them with a live beach cam and exquisite aerial footage of both Carolina and Kure Beaches.
